In old days, fishermen along seaside
thought that the whale was so good-tempered, hurt no one but helped
people when they had confronted storm in the sea. Taking advantage of
this, someone embroidered several legends on the whale, which was
joined to the life of Nguyen Anh during the time of his traveling and
running away, coloring stories in which the whale saved Nguyen Anh from
shipwreck, using devine power to praise this person.
This festival last for two days from the middle of the 3rd month of the lunar calendar. On this occasion, the whale temple, as well as all the houses and boats, are beautifully decorated.
The peace offering is conducted in the first evening at the whale temple by village elders. Offerings do not contain sea foods and are given while the oration is read out. The ceremony is held to respect the Whale God and to pray for the safety and propriety of the village.
At dawn the following day, there will be a procession of boats on the sea in a set formation. This procession displays the fishermens' sincerity to their Whale God. By midnight, the official ceremony is conducted as school children offer incense and the orchestra plays a classical opera. All the fishing boats and villagers, no matter where they are, will return to take part in the Whale Festival.
